A young family is enjoying living the dream thanks to Arley Homes. The Cleasby family fell in love with the St Georges Park development in Mossley but mum Sarah feared the stunning four-bedroom property would be out of their price range.
Following a viewing of the beautiful Harridge S show home, the couple discussed possible options for making the move and were delighted to discover Arley Homes offered a tailor-made part-exchange package.
Arley put together a deal to enable Sarah, her husband Chris, and their children Paige, 13, Madeline, 10, and Elliot, four, to part exchange their three-bedroom home against the property at St Georges Park.
Their previous home, also in Mossley, was valued at approximately two thirds of the price of the new home, making it perfect for part exchange. Sarah said: I am quite cynical and was worried the part exchange offer would be less than we hoped for, so I had my own valuations done. I was surprised and extremely pleased to find Arley Homes valuation came out the same and felt really happy about the deal.
Having lived in a traditional 150 year old Victorian terrace, Sarah had reservations about purchasing a new build property until she saw the development for herself. I always associated new build with bland and boxy but that was before I came to St Georges Park. The development features a range of different house styles and each home is individual, she said.
My house is simply beautiful. I love the quirkiness, its full of nooks and crannies and has such character, it is like living in a more traditional style of home without all the problems. We were able to move straight in without worrying about having to decorate. Theres no issue with pipes, electrics or the roof as you often find in older properties. Its ideal for families, with a large open plan kitchen diner and a master suite on the top floor where we go to escape the hustle and bustle.
All three children attend local schools and Sarah was determined her young family should benefit from all that Mossely has to offer. She said: I grew up near to here, with the countryside on my doorstep, and I always wanted my children to have the countryside outside their window.
This is such a wonderful location an idyllic place for children. We all enjoy wandering down the canal tow path to the coffee shops at Uppermill or playing in the fields. They love it and I cant think of anywhere else I would rather be.
Overlooking the Huddersfield Narrow Canal, St Georges Park is just minutes from the centre of the pretty town of Mossley. The semi- rural setting, in the heart of the Tame valley, offers the perfect blend of countryside living with the convenience of having Ashton-Under-Lyne and Manchester City Centre an easy drive away.
St Georges Park offers a mixture of three- , four- and five- bedroom family homes, and two-bedroom apartments. Only four apartments remain, priced from £129,950, while townhouses start at £219,950.
